O.K....
This is an every-Friday-Nite event. People/cars show up, park, wander, B.S., etc., etc. Show is right on Main St. downtown Somerville - drop down 202 to the Somerville circle, and go east to Main St.
Plenty informal....just find a place to park and drift arund looking at all that's there. Cars come and go (to some extent), cruise the main drag. That's pretty much it. There's really nuthin to plan for; show up and gawk is what it's about. But show up after about 6 and parking is non-existant. Not a problem unless you want to walk around looking at stuff. |
